Shooting isn't just about throwing lead downrange.
You learn to Aim, Focus, Concentrate, and use your fundamentals to ensure you meet your objective.
We can hone those skills and transfer them to our everyday lives.
Aim - Goals
Focus - Get Rid of What's Not Important
Concentrate - Ensure what you want stays in your sights
Fundamentals:
Trigger Control - Adjust your touch
Breath - Find your rhythm
Follow Through - Finish what you start
Adjust - See how close your were to hitting your target and make small adjustments
Next time you hit the range, use this to make you a better shooter and afterwards make some new goals to hit.
